What you'll be doing
Preparing drainage strategies and engineering reports to support planning applications
Producing technical drawings including sketch and preliminary highway designs, drainage and external works layouts
Delivering ground modelling and S104, S278 and S38 designs through to technical approval
Mentoring and supporting junior team members
Liaising with clients, stakeholders and external project teams
Undertaking site visits when required
Obtaining third-party information such as utility searches and background drawings
Working collaboratively within a multidisciplinary design team
This is primarily a desk-based role with occasional site visits, offering a strong balance of technical delivery and team collaboration.
What you'll bring
Experience in civil / development infrastructure design
Ability to prepare drainage strategies, engineering reports and technical drawings
Knowledge of S104, S278 and S38 processes
Strong communication and organisational skills
A collaborative, proactive approach to project delivery
